Output b77d264c8a7d2efcf91a7dc32405c49558f200638cf2143ec119b69ccf4265df:1

value
369440788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3ffca634491ccb3c24bbf69b0c5be5737461bd OP_EQUAL
address
3HDDT3UQwxZzwpJ48U98C3roe1jHbmzRLe
transaction
b77d264c8a7d2efcf91a7dc32405c49558f200638cf2143ec119b69ccf4265df
spent
true